Are meteorites radioactive?
The quick reply isn’t any. The percentages of a meteorite emitting any type of dangerous radiation are near zero. As a matter of truth, it’s extra possible for a random rock from Earth to be radioactive than a meteorite.
Listed below are some frequent misconceptions about radiation and meteorites that lead individuals to consider that these house rocks might be harmful.
Saved radiation
Radiation can’t be “saved” in an object. Any radiation that the meteorite was uncovered to in house within the type of x-rays, gamma rays, etcetera. merely went by way of it. and continued its path.
When a meteorite enters Earth it doesn’t include or emit or let in any form of cosmic radiation.


Radioactive supplies on meteorites
One other frequent perception is that meteorites might include some quantity of radioactive supplies that would emit their very own radiation.
Right here there’s a small clarification that we have to make.
Just about each rock on Earth or house accommodates doubtlessly radioactive supplies. That’s as a result of as a result of all of them include not less than one of many frequent radioactive supplies. These are Potassium (Ok), Thorium (Th), and Uranium (U).
Even when a rock accommodates excessive quantities of a radioactive factor, the chances of it being harmful are extraordinarily low. Even larger focus uranium isn’t notably radioactive. Extremely radioactive uranium must be created by refining uranium ore into pure uranium metallic. This isn’t a naturally occurring course of and requires human intervention.
On prime of that, the amount of radioactive supplies discovered on meteorites is extraordinarily low. It’s extra possible for an Earth rock to include the next quantity of uranium than a meteorite. It is because deposits of those supplies have been created naturally over tens of millions of years, however this course of doesn’t happen on meteorites as they don’t have a altering surroundings like Earth the place there’s seismic exercise, climate, ocean currents, and different ever-changing components.
What’s radioactivity anyway?
Radioactivity is the spontaneous emission of radiation from the nucleus of an unstable atom because it seeks a extra steady configuration. At its core, radioactivity arises from the imbalance between the robust nuclear pressure, which binds protons and neutrons collectively, and different forces throughout the nucleus. In consequence, sure atoms endure radioactive decay, remodeling into completely different parts and emitting varied forms of radiation within the course of.
Quite a few supplies exhibit radioactive properties, with among the commonest being isotopes of parts like uranium, thorium, and radium. These parts have inherently unstable nuclei, resulting in the continual emission of alpha particles, beta particles, or gamma rays. These radioactive supplies are in all places in nature and might be present in soil, rocks, and even hint quantities within the human physique.
Whereas some radioactive supplies happen naturally, others are produced artificially by way of processes like nuclear fission in reactors or particle accelerators, serving varied functions in drugs, business, and analysis.
Conclusion
You probably have been fortunate sufficient to discover a meteorite, it’s not harmful to deal with it. Meteorites are usually not radioactive.
Nonetheless, I’d nonetheless advocate to make use of gloves or pincers. To not defend your self from the meteorite, however the different manner round. Watch out when dealing with a meteorite piece as a result of your palms might need oils and micro organism that would contaminate the pattern in case it’s fascinating sufficient to review.
